### Runbook: Report export timezone mismatches (Glimmerfield)

If a customer reports that exported totals differ from the dashboard, check whether their report schedule predates the March cutover — older schedules still render in server-local time rather than the account timezone. Re-saving the schedule fixes it. Before escalating, confirm the export worker is running with the expected timezone settings shown below.

config for kadup-kajog:
[raldor]
host = raldor.tolvaqworks.internal
user = raldor_svc
database = raldor_prod

All visitors to the Thornleigh Building must be pre-registered by their host at least one business day in advance. On arrival, team assistants should verify identity, issue a dated visitor sticker, and record the host's name in the front-desk ledger. Visitors must be escorted at all times beyond the lobby; unaccompanied visitors should be returned to reception immediately. Should the escort need to admit a visitor through the inner doors, the keypad accepts the code below.

door code, yagap-bahof: bdg-O-05

Renamed setting: DISPATCH_MODE is now LIFTSIM_DISPATCH_STRATEGY. Old name is ignored as of this release — no fallback, no warning in quiet mode. Contractors: grep your env files and update before deploying, or the simulator silently reverts to round-robin dispatch and your Harwick Tower scenario results will be garbage. Accepted values are unchanged: nearest-car, zoned, predictive. LIFTSIM_FLOOR_CACHE also moved to the new prefix. One more thing: the telemetry exporter now requires its credential in the env file, set on the line that follows.

vault entry, kafog-yahop: COURIER_KEY8=0faa53ae

- [ ] **Step 7: Breaker override escrow.** After sealing the signing keys for the Tallgrove upstream API circuit breaker, confirm the support team can force the breaker open during a full outage. The override bundle lives in the sealed escrow drawer and is useless without its unlock phrase. Two ceremony witnesses must initial this step before proceeding. The escrow bundle is decrypted with the recovery passphrase that follows.

vault phrase of kahip-kahop = holath-quenmir